Detect Heat, Not Light: FLIR Thermal Imaging Cameras

FLIR thermal imaging cameras revolutionize the way we view our world. Unlike traditional devices that capture visible light, FLIR cameras detect infrared radiation emitted by objects. This allows us to identify temperature differences, even in obscured environments. Whether you're a professional in fields like construction or simply enthusiastic about exploring the unseen world, FLIR thermal imaging offers a unique perspective.

  • Applications of FLIR cameras are vast and varied:
  • Locating heat loss in buildings
  • Evaluating electrical equipment for overheating
  • Pinpointing wildlife in their natural habitats
  • Supporting search and rescue operations

Exploring the Invisible: FLIR Thermal Imaging

The world we perceive is limited by our eyes, which can only detect a narrow band of electromagnetic radiation known as visible light. However, beyond this visible spectrum lies a wealth of information hidden in infrared (IR) radiation, which emits heat energy. FLIR thermal imaging leverage this power, revealing temperature variations invisible to the human eye. This exceptional technology has revolutionized numerous fields, from search and rescue operations to astronomy. By detecting these minute heat differences, FLIR cameras offer a unique perspective on our surroundings, enabling users to identify problems, monitor performance, and improve efficiency in ways never before possible.
